Discover Summer Magic In Ruidoso

Nestled in the Sierra Blanca mountain range of southern New Mexico, Ruidoso is a hidden gem that comes alive in the summer. With its cool mountain air, lush forests, and a variety of outdoor activities, Ruidoso offers a perfect escape from the summer heat. Here are some top attractions to explore during your summer visit to Ruidoso.




1. Ruidoso Downs Race Track and Casino

Experience the thrill of live horse racing at the Ruidoso Downs Race Track, home to the prestigious All American Futurity. Place your bets, enjoy the races, and soak up the lively atmosphere. Adjacent to the track, the Billy the Kid Casino offers a range of gaming options and entertainment for those looking to try their luck indoors.




2. Grindstone Lake and Trails

Grindstone Lake is a favorite summer destination for outdoor enthusiasts. Enjoy a day of fishing, kayaking, or paddleboarding on the serene waters. Wibit Water Park, an inflatable, on-water obstacle course on the lake, provides hours of fun for all ages. The surrounding trails offer excellent opportunities for hiking, mountain biking, and horseback riding, with scenic views of the lake and mountains. There’s also a disc golf course for a fun family activity.

3. Lincoln National Forest

Explore the natural beauty of Lincoln National Forest, a sprawling wilderness area offering a plethora of outdoor activities. Hike through lush pine forests, discover hidden waterfalls, and enjoy picnicking in scenic spots. The forest is also home to diverse wildlife, making it a great destination for nature lovers and photographers.

4. Ruidoso River Park

Located in the heart of the village, Ruidoso River Park is a lovely spot for a leisurely afternoon. The park features walking trails, picnic areas, and a tranquil river perfect for a relaxing stroll or a family picnic. The well-maintained grounds and beautiful surroundings make it a local favorite.

5. Flying J Ranch

Step back in time at the Flying J Ranch, where you can experience the charm of the Old West. The ranch offers chuckwagon suppers, cowboy music, and gunfight reenactments. It’s a family-friendly attraction that provides a fun and educational glimpse into the region’s cowboy heritage.




6. Noisy Water Winery

Wine enthusiasts should not miss a visit to Noisy Water Winery. Sample a variety of award-winning wines and local cheeses, and enjoy the relaxed, friendly atmosphere. The winery also offers unique New Mexico products, making it a great place to pick up souvenirs or gifts.

7. Ruidoso Art Galleries

Ruidoso boasts a vibrant arts scene with several galleries showcasing local and regional artists. Visit the Hurd La Rinconada Gallery to see works by the famous Wyeth/Hurd family of artists or explore the diverse offerings at the Tanner Tradition Gallery. Art lovers will find plenty to inspire and enjoy.

8. Alto Lake and Recreation Area

Just a short drive from Ruidoso, Alto Lake is another picturesque spot for outdoor activities. Enjoy fishing, paddleboarding, or simply relaxing by the water. The recreation area also features well-maintained trails for hiking and horseback riding, offering beautiful views of the surrounding mountains and forest.

9. Inn of the Mountain Gods Resort and Casino

For a mix of luxury and adventure, visit the Inn of the Mountain Gods Resort and Casino. Set on the shores of Lake Mescalero, the resort offers a variety of activities, including boating, zip-lining, and golf. The casino provides gaming excitement, and the resort’s dining options cater to all tastes. It’s a great place to unwind and enjoy some pampering.




10. Ruidoso Winter Park

While known for its winter activities, Ruidoso Winter Park transforms into a summer playground with its Adventure Park. Enjoy summer tubing on specially designed lanes, ride the zip lines, or try out the new mountain coaster for an exhilarating experience. It’s a perfect spot for family fun and thrills.

11. Spencer Theater for the Performing Arts

Experience world-class entertainment at the Spencer Theater for the Performing Arts. This stunning venue hosts a variety of performances, including concerts, theater productions, and dance shows. The theater’s striking architecture and beautiful setting add to the overall experience, making it a cultural highlight of any visit to Ruidoso.

12. Ski Apache

Even in summer, Ski Apache offers plenty of activities. Take a scenic gondola ride to the top of Sierra Blanca Peak for breathtaking views or enjoy the thrill of mountain biking and hiking on the trails. The cooler mountain temperatures provide a refreshing escape from the summer heat.
